android - 蓝牙串口通讯,HC-06模块转安卓手机

标签 android c++ c bluetooth arduino

我想将数据从 Arduino 传输到 android 手机。数据将是整数,它们是从连接到 Arduino 的传感器连续生成的值。最快的方法是什么?我的意思是,没有任何延迟地传输此数据的最佳代码是什么?我想使用最优化的代码,因为在我的项目中,延迟会导致我的 android 应用程序出错。请帮助我。数据速率约为每毫秒 1 个整数。提前致谢....

最佳答案

我已经成功地使用以下 Google Developers 指南中的教程创建了与蓝牙棒阅读器(牛耳标签)的连接并从中接收数据。在我看来,它会一直全天候收听消息。

https://developer.android.com/guide/topics/connectivity/bluetooth.html

它适用于 >= Android 4.3,因为只有在此版本之后,Android 才能接收低功耗蓝牙。

关于android - 蓝牙串口通讯,HC-06模块转安卓手机,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40436928/

相关文章:

android - Android-等待在ViewModel中初始化变量以在Fragment中进行

android - 如何在 Google Play 商店中显示对精简版应用程序的推荐?

C++ Curl文件下载-错误检查

c - C语言的事件管理

在 GCC 中编译而不生成输出文件

android - 使用 onSaveInstanceState 问题

java - android 正则表达式提取数据时出现问题 - 日志上的 PID

c++ - 我如何为类的函数成员进行以下工作?

c++ - 重新分配 "random"崩溃

c++ - 在C和C++中,链接器如何找到具有已实现功能的正确文件?